Performance study on resistance reduction of short vertical grounding rod in small ground grids

Abstract
In order to study the resistance-reducing effect of the short vertical grounding rod commonly used in projects, this paper performs on the simulation study for the grounding grids used in the radar and other military positions. In terms of such two aspects as the layout location and mounting number, for the uniform soil, and in view of the reflection coefficient and the thickness of the upper layer of soil, it studies the resistance-reducing effect of the short vertical grounding rod, for the two layer soil. Research results show that the short vertical grounding rod is of a certain resistance-reducing effect on the small ground grids and have the best effect when the rod is mounted to the edge of grounding, the resistance-reducing rate decreases clearly as the reflection coefficient increases in the two-layer soil, which provides some reference for the grounding project.关键词
